[0001] This invention relates to a demolding and extraction device and method for a hat-shaped reinforced wall panel forming airbag. Background Technology

[0002] With the development of China's domestically produced large aircraft and unmanned aerial vehicle (UAV) industries, hat-shaped stiffened panel components are widely used in the aerospace field due to their superior mechanical properties. For example... Figure 1 As shown, the hat-shaped stiffened panel is a typical structure for current passenger aircraft fuselage panels. For example, the front and rear fuselage panels of the C919 aircraft both use this structure.

[0003] The preparation of hat-shaped stiffened panels requires the use of co-curing molding process to improve the overall structural integrity of the parts. The main characteristics of the co-curing molded hat-shaped stiffened panels are as follows: (1) an airbag is used as the core mold to form its hat-shaped part. By introducing the pressure of the autoclave into the airbag, the pressure of the hat-shaped part is uniform and the molding quality is good; (2) a pressure pad is used to uniformly press the skin. Through the stiffness designability, the pressure transmission of the product in the area of ​​severe delamination or transition can be met, and the molding quality of the product can be guaranteed. At present, the hat-shaped stiffened panel products manufactured by co-curing molding technology have all passed multiple quality tests such as profile, axis, thickness, porosity, and ultrasonic non-destructive testing. All indicators meet the engineering requirements of product model, acceptance technical conditions, airworthiness and installation. Nowadays, this co-curing molding technology has been extended to the key technology research of the test piece of the self-controlled and controllable automatic wire laying panel of the rear fuselage section of the CR929 wide-body passenger aircraft, and has been successfully verified in the 1-meter wide-body rear fuselage panel.

[0004] Currently, after the cap-shaped reinforced panel is formed, the airbag is mainly removed manually. However, because the airbag is located in a cap-shaped structure that is closed on three sides, and because the cap-shaped part of the panel is thin and long, the airbag adheres tightly to the inner wall of the cap cavity after forming in the autoclave. It requires enormous external force to remove it, making airbag demolding difficult, especially for large cap-shaped reinforced panel parts. In such cases, it requires more than a dozen workers to pull the airbag out, resulting in extremely high labor costs. A more significant problem is that manual removal can also lead to uneven force distribution, causing the airbag to break inside the cavity and rendering the part unusable.

[0005] Therefore, how to easily and effectively demold the airbag after the hat-shaped reinforced wall panel is formed remains an urgent problem to be solved. Summary of the Invention

[0039] Example 1

[0040] This embodiment is a demolding and extraction device for a hat-shaped reinforced wall panel forming airbag, such as... Figure 2 and Figure 3 As shown, the device includes a base platform 1, a pull-out actuator 2 mounted on the base platform 1, and a drive mechanism 3 that provides power to the pull-out actuator 2. The base platform 1 has a baffle 4 at its front end, and the pull-out actuator 2 has an airbag clamp 5 at its front end. The cured cap-shaped reinforced wall panel is placed at the front end of the baffle 4, and the airbag exposed outside the cavity of the cap-shaped wall panel is clamped on the airbag clamp 5. The drive mechanism 3 drives the pull-out actuator 2 to pull out the airbag at a uniform speed, thereby effectively solving the problem of airbag breakage due to uneven force, and providing favorable conditions for the mechanized and standardized production of cap-shaped reinforced wall panel parts.

[0041] In this embodiment, the driving mechanism 3 is a hydraulic press; the extraction actuator 2 is a hydraulic telescopic rod, which includes a hydraulic cylinder 21 and a telescopic rod body 22 built into the hydraulic cylinder 21; the hydraulic telescopic rod is set on the platform of the base platform 1 through the sliding base 6, and the end of the telescopic rod body 22 faces the baffle 4 at the front end of the base platform 1; the hydraulic press is installed above the extraction actuator 2 through the frame 7, and is connected to the oil hole 211 on the hydraulic cylinder 21 through the hydraulic oil pipe 8 to drive the telescopic rod body 22 to extend and retract. The advantage of using a hydraulic control system is that by controlling and adjusting the flow direction, pressure and flow rate of the oil in the hydraulic system, the actuator can obtain the required movement direction, thrust (torque) and movement speed (rotation speed), etc., so as to set the appropriate pulling force and extraction direction according to the material and size of the airbag to be extracted, and ensure that the airbag is completely extracted.

[0042] In this embodiment, the cap-shaped reinforced wall panel molding airbag demolding and extraction device includes a sliding base 6 comprising two longitudinally fixed sliding grooves 61 on a base platform 1 and a base plate 62 that is clamped onto the sliding grooves 61 and can slide along the sliding grooves 61. The base plate 62 is also provided with a clamp 63 to fix the hydraulic telescopic rod to the base plate 62. A limiting block 64 is provided at the front end of the base plate 62 to limit the installation of the hydraulic telescopic rod and to limit and guide the extension and retraction movement of its telescopic rod body 22. The base plate 62 is fixed to the sliding grooves 61 by pins, and the position of the extraction actuator 2 on the sliding base 6 is adjusted according to the length of the airbag to be extracted. The clamp 63 can be customized according to the size of the extraction actuator 2 and is detachable, facilitating the replacement and maintenance of the extraction actuator 2. Meanwhile, the sliding base not only provides support for the extraction actuator, but also allows the airbag extraction device to adapt to the extraction of airbags of different lengths. During the extraction process, the hydraulic rod is fixed to prevent left and right swaying, ensure the direction of airbag extraction, and ensure that the airbag is subjected to uniform force and safely pulled out.

[0043] In this embodiment, the airbag clamp 5 is a segmented design, such as... Figure 4 As shown, it includes a first gripper body 51 and a second gripper body 52, and a connecting rod 53 for connecting to the hydraulic telescopic rod. The first gripper body 51 and the second gripper body 52 are connected and clamped together by bolts 54 to hold and fix the airbag exposed outside the cavity of the cap-shaped wall panel. The inner surfaces of the first gripper body 51 and the second gripper body 52 are provided with serrated protrusions 55. The connecting rod 53 is fixed to the body of one of the grippers. The connecting rod 53 can be detachably connected to the telescopic rod body, for example by clamping or screwing, so as to replace the airbag clamp 5 later, facilitate maintenance and adapt to airbags of different sizes. The serrated protrusions in its inner cavity can clamp the airbag tightly so that it does not fall off during withdrawal. The clamp is designed as a split type, and its size is adjustable, so it can be used to match airbags of different sizes, expanding the applicability of the withdrawal device.

[0044] In addition, in this embodiment, a buffer pad is provided in front of the baffle 4 at the front end of the base platform 1 to prevent damage during the installation and fixing of the cap-shaped wall panel and during the extraction of the airbag. The buffer pad can be a rubber pad, silicone pad, latex pad or sponge pad, etc., and can be glued to the baffle 4. Its thickness can be designed as needed, and the thickness is 50-100mm.

[0045] Furthermore, the cap-shaped reinforced wall panel molding airbag demolding and extraction device described in this embodiment is also equipped with a vacuum device 9. This device removes the gas from the airbag, causing it to contract and separate from the inner wall of the cap-shaped cavity for extraction. Multiple sets of rollers 10 with foot brakes are also provided under the base platform 1, such as casters with foot brakes; and a pull rod handle 11 is provided at the rear end of the base platform 1 to facilitate movement of the device for extracting airbags at different positions on the cap-shaped reinforced wall panel. This flexible operation allows the device to adapt to more scenarios and avoids moving the cap-shaped reinforced wall panel itself, saving manpower and preventing damage during part handling.

[0046] Example 2

[0047] This embodiment describes the extraction of a hat-shaped reinforced wall panel using the extraction device described in Embodiment 1. Figure 5 As shown, the hat-shaped reinforced wall panel contains 14 hat-shaped reinforcing ribs, with the longest hat-shaped reinforcing rib being 2.9 meters long. It takes several people working together to pull out the airbag, and there is a significant risk that the airbag will break and cause the part to be scrapped.

[0048] This embodiment demonstrates the process of extracting the airbag using the device of the present invention; that is, the extraction device described in Embodiment 1 is moved to one end of the cured cap-shaped reinforced wall panel, the baffle 4 at the front end of the base platform 1 is aligned with one of the cap-shaped ribs, and the airbag with the end of the cap-shaped rib exposed outside the cavity of the cap-shaped wall panel is clamped on the airbag clamp 5. The drive mechanism 3 is activated to drive the extraction execution mechanism 2 to extract the airbag at a uniform speed. The specific extraction process includes the following steps:

[0049] 1) Remove the cured cap-shaped reinforced wall panel from the autoclave and place it in the designated demolding area.

[0050] 2) Push the extraction device to one end of the cap-shaped reinforced wall panel, select one of the cap-shaped ribs, and press the outer side of the baffle 4 of the extraction device against the end of the cap-shaped rib.

[0051] 3) Adjust the position of the extraction actuator 2 so that the stroke of the telescopic rod body 22 is sufficient to extract the air bladder in the cap-shaped rib to be demolded.

[0052] 4) Connect the end of the airbag exposed outside the cavity of the cap-shaped wall panel to the vacuum nozzle, and start the vacuum pumping device 9 to extract the gas in the airbag. The pressure inside the airbag reaches -50 to -100 kPa. In this embodiment, it is controlled to be -80 kPa.

[0053] 5) Simultaneously start the drive mechanism 3, so that the front end of the telescopic rod body 22 of the extraction actuator 2 approaches the baffle 4, and the airbag end to be extracted is clamped by the airbag clamp 5.

[0054] 6) Restart the hydraulic press of drive mechanism 3 to drive the telescopic rod body 22 back to the starting position, thereby extracting the airbag; the pulling force is 500-1000N, and 600N in this embodiment.

[0055] 7) After the airbag is removed, release the airbag clamp 5, remove the airbag, and transfer the removal device to another cap-shaped rib to be demolded. Repeat steps 2 to 6 until all airbags on the cap-shaped reinforced wall panel are removed.

[0056] In this embodiment, one extraction device is used to extract the airbags one by one. However, in order to speed up the extraction, multiple extraction devices can be used simultaneously, which greatly saves manpower and extraction time. Moreover, the extracted airbags do not break, and the effect is remarkable.
